Output 70f255af2611962aeab20722eb0c6818cc7a9fbc835489721a5ed8da17449901:29

value
133560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a057a3bbf1dc42f8341cdc334c05cdb0ac9f08c OP_EQUAL
address
3FjQYfemLEUYQjbCZaK2BL7ELTQwwPx78L
transaction
70f255af2611962aeab20722eb0c6818cc7a9fbc835489721a5ed8da17449901
spent
true